Table 2.

Clones isolated with RaSH with the restriction enzyme EcoRII

Nomenclature* Identity Mda type
mda-E-28, E-34, E-38, E-41, E-45, E-49, E-50 Fibronectin Type IV
mda-E-31 2′-5′ oligoadenylate synthetase Type I
mda-E-32, E-57, E-58 LIF Type II
mda-E-35 Transporter 1, ABC Type I
mda-E-36, E-42, E-52 HLA-B Type I
mda-E-39 KIAA0180 Type II
mda-E-40 Vimentin Type I
mda-E-44 Tumor necrosis factor-α Type II
mda-E-46, E-55 Calcium-activated potassium channel Type IV
mda-E-47 Ninjurin 1 Type IV
mda-E-51 HMG-Y protein isoform Type I
mda-E-54 Proteasome 26S subunit Type IV
mda-E-61 Human GADD34 Type II
mda-E-68 mda-6 (p21, Waf1, CIP1, SDI1) Type IV
mda-E-43, E-63, E-64 Novel Type I
*

Clones are designated as melanoma differentiation-associated (mda) and the E designation refers to the fact that the restriction enzyme EcoRII was used for isolation by the RaSH approach. 

Sequences were searched against various DNA databases to determine sequence identities. Novel, no similar sequence reported in current DNA databases. 

Type I mda gene, inducible by IFN-β and IFN-β + MEZ; Type II mda gene, inducible by MEZ and IFN-β + MEZ; Type III mda gene, inducible by IFN-β, MEZ and IFN-β + MEZ; Type IV mda gene, inducible predominantly by IFN-β + MEZ.
